Hit up this cafe if you fancy a ball of cotton candy suspended over your cup of coffee

Mellower Coffee, a cafe chain from Shanghai, has opened a chillax space along Robinson Road filled with cosy couches and industrial vibes. Amongst the coffees on the menu, one stands out for its unique concept.

Sweet Little Rain ($9.80), a creation by Mellower Coffee’s Korean barista champion, is basically a giant ball of cotton candy suspended in the air above a cup of Americano. It’s the steam from the java that rises up to melt the sugary treat, which in turn drips into the cup to sweeten it. The presentation is pretty, for sure, but you’ll have to wait patiently for the candy floss to melt — or risk getting impatient and tearing it off with your bare hands. 

If you worry you’ll snack on the cotton candy before it has a chance to dissolve, go with the more standard orders of caffe latte ($6), iced americano ($5.20) or Mellower Dutch cold brew ($6.80).

Oh, and the cafe is set to open its bigger and shinier two-storey global flagship at Bugis in the next few weeks, so keep an eye out for that. 

Mellower Coffee is at #01-03, 77 Robinson Rd. Mon-Fri 8am-7.30pm, Sat 9am-4.30pm.
